+ /**
+ * Installs DOM-level keydown/keyup listeners that synthesise
+ * keyup events for non-Meta keys whose natural keyup was
+ * swallowed by macOS while a Meta key was held.
+ *
+ * macOS suppresses keyUp events for non-modifier keys whose keyUp
+ * would occur while a Meta (CMD) key is held. THis is an OS-level
+ * behaviour inherited by Chrome, Safari and Firefox (open
+ * browser bugs dating back to 2011, still unresolved as of
+ * writing). The consequence in libGDX's GWT backend
+ * (DefaultGwtInput.java) is that its internal pressedKeys[]
+ * array gets stuck `true` for the un-released key. Typical
+ * symptom for Oric input behaviour: after CMD+X, X stays pressed,
+ * generating auto-repeat X inputs until the next plain X press.
+ *
+ * The workaround is to listen at the DOM level (capture phase, so
+ * we run before libGDX's own document-level bubble-phase listener).
+ * On every keydown/keyup, observe event.metaKey to track Meta
+ * pressed/released. On the released transition, dispatch a
+ * synthetic keyup for every non-Meta key whose keydown we saw
+ * without a subsequent keyup. The synthetic events flow through
+ * libGDX's normal keyup handler, which clears its internal
+ * pressedKeys[] state. (Note that in the case where a non-Meta
+ * key is still held down when Meta is released, MacOS appears
+ * to generate suitable key events so they effectively appear as
+ * new key presses without the Meta modifier.)
+ */
